No More Meltdowns: Choosing Chemical Resistant Floor Coatings

Why Your Concrete Floor Needs a Shield

Chemical resistant floor coatings are specialized protective systems designed to create an impermeable barrier between harsh substances and your concrete substrate. Whether you’re dealing with battery acid in your garage, cleaning chemicals in your workspace, or industrial solvents in a manufacturing facility, these advanced coatings prevent costly damage and deterioration.

Quick Guide to Chemical Resistant Floor Coatings:

  • Epoxy Systems – General chemical resistance with seamless finish
  • Novolac Epoxy – Superior acid resistance for harsh chemicals
  • Polyurethane – Excellent abrasion and UV resistance
  • Polyaspartic – Fast cure times with outstanding durability
  • Cementitious Urethane – Heat and thermal shock resistance

Without proper protection, concrete floors are porous by nature and will absorb solvents, acids, and other compounds that deteriorate the surface from within. As one facility manager finded, “acid spills can rapidly damage any concrete floor lacking proper protection,” often turning the surface yellowish and exposing aggregate as chemicals eat away at the concrete.

These protective coatings work by bonding directly to the substrate to create a seamless, non-porous surface that prevents aggressive chemicals from seeping into cracks or joints. The result is a floor that can withstand everything from intermittent spills to constant chemical immersion while lasting 10 to 20 years or more with proper installation and maintenance.

Extreme Durability

Industrial environments and busy garages demand flooring that can take a beating. Our chemical resistant floor coatings are engineered to handle whatever you throw at them – sometimes literally.

Abrasion resistance is where the science gets interesting. We measure this using the industry-standard Taber C-17 test, which simulates wear and tear by measuring how much material gets removed by an abrasion wheel. Lower numbers mean better resistance. An industrial-grade coating might show 5-10 mg of abrasion loss, while military-grade coatings come in under 5 mg. To put that in perspective, a 10 mg rated coating lasts about 3-4 times longer than a 20 mg coating!

Impact protection is equally impressive. Our coatings can reach compressive strengths up to 9,900 PSI – that’s twice as strong as most concrete. Dropped tools, heavy machinery, constant vehicle traffic – your floor can handle it without showing significant wear.

Thermal shock stability becomes critical in facilities that experience rapid temperature changes. Think aggressive wash-downs or areas that go from hot to cold quickly. Certain systems like cementitious urethanes prevent the cracking and delamination that can happen with less robust materials.

The longevity factor is where everything comes together. When properly installed and maintained, these coatings are designed to last 10 to 20 years or more. That long-term performance translates directly into long-term savings.

Epoxy and Novolac Epoxy Systems

Epoxy has been the workhorse of industrial flooring for decades, and for good reason. These systems create that seamless, glossy finish that not only looks professional but provides serious protection.

100% solids epoxy is our go-to for general chemical resistance, delivering maximum performance and longevity. The self-leveling properties create a smooth, non-porous surface that laughs off most spills and stains. Regular cleaning becomes a breeze – just mop and go.

But here’s where it gets interesting: when you’re dealing with really aggressive chemicals – think battery acid, strong solvents, or caustic cleaning solutions – that’s when we bring out the big guns with Novolac epoxy systems.

Novolac isn’t just a fancy name; it’s a completely different animal. These specialized epoxy coatings are engineered to withstand severe chemical attacks that would eat through standard epoxy. We’re talking about secondary containment areas, chemical storage facilities, or anywhere you might have prolonged exposure to harsh substances.

The difference is dramatic. While regular epoxy might handle an occasional spill just fine, Novolac epoxy can handle immersion in aggressive chemicals without breaking a sweat. Polyurethane and Cementitious Urethane

Polyurethane systems bring something special to the table, especially when durability and temperature resistance matter most.

Polyurethane topcoats are like the protective big brother of the coating world. We often apply them over epoxy base coats because they offer exceptional abrasion and scratch resistance. If you’ve got heavy equipment rolling around or constant foot traffic, polyurethane laughs it off. Plus, unlike some epoxies that can yellow over time, polyurethane maintains its UV stability – crucial for garage floors near those big overhead doors that let in Colorado sunshine.

Now, cementitious urethane – that’s where things get really impressive. These systems are the ultimate choice for environments that face serious thermal challenges. Picture a commercial kitchen with constant hot wash-downs, or a food processing plant that needs to meet strict USDA standards while handling temperature swings that would crack lesser coatings.

Cementitious urethane systems are moisture-tolerant during installation, which means we can apply them even in humid or damp conditions where other coatings might fail. They’re particularly popular in the food and beverage industry because they meet stringent hygiene requirements while standing up to aggressive cleaning protocols.

Polyaspartic Coatings: The Modern Standard

Here’s where coating technology gets exciting. Polyaspartic systems represent a major leap forward, combining rapid cure times with outstanding performance that makes them our modern standard for most applications.

The speed is honestly impressive – we can transform your garage from concrete gray to showroom quality in one day. No more waiting around for days while your floor cures. The rapid cure times mean minimal disruption whether you’re a homeowner wanting your garage back or a business that can’t afford extended downtime.

But speed means nothing without durability, and that’s where polyaspartic really shines. These coatings offer excellent durability against abrasion, impact, and chemical exposure. They’re tough enough for commercial spaces yet perfect for residential garages where you want that clean, professional look.

The UV stability is particularly important here in Colorado. While standard epoxy might yellow or amber over time when exposed to sunlight streaming through garage doors, polyaspartic maintains its color and clarity indefinitely. Your floor will look as good in five years as it does the day we finish.

We also appreciate that polyaspartic systems are low in VOCs, which means better air quality during installation and no lingering chemical odors. This makes them ideal for garages and commercial spaces where people work or spend time regularly.

FeatureEpoxyPolyurethanePolyaspartic
Cure TimeModerate (24-72 hours for light traffic)Moderate to FastVery Fast (hours, often 1-day install)
UV StabilityPoor (can yellow over time)Good (especially as a topcoat)Excellent (non-yellowing)
Chemical ResistanceGood (general), Excellent (Novolac)Good (solvents, acids, alkalis)Excellent (broad spectrum)
Abrasion ResistanceGoodExcellentExcellent
Shore D Hardness80-8585-9088-92+

How to Choose the Right Chemical Resistant Floor Coatings

Selecting the perfect chemical resistant floor coating for your space requires understanding your unique environment and operational needs. Over the years, I’ve learned that the most successful installations start with asking the right questions and carefully analyzing your specific situation.

The first and most critical factor is chemical exposure analysis. We need to dig deep into exactly what substances your floor will encounter. Are we talking about occasional battery acid drips in your garage, or constant exposure to cleaning chemicals in a food processing facility? The type, concentration, and duration of chemical contact makes all the difference in our recommendation.

For example, if you’re dealing with high concentrations of acids or chlorinated solvents, we’ll likely recommend a Novolac epoxy system specifically engineered for these harsh conditions. But if your exposure is more about general spills and splashes, a high-quality standard epoxy might provide excellent protection at a more economical price point.

Traffic assessment is equally important. A residential garage sees very different demands than a warehouse with constant forklift traffic. We evaluate whether you’re dealing with light foot traffic, heavy equipment movement, or something in between. This directly impacts the abrasion resistance and compressive strength requirements for your coating.

Temperature conditions can make or break a flooring system. Will your floor experience extreme heat, freezing cold, or rapid temperature changes from wash-downs? These thermal shock conditions are where specialized systems like cementitious urethane truly shine, offering stability that standard coatings simply can’t match.

Your desired lifespan helps us balance performance with investment. While all our coatings are built for longevity, understanding whether you need a 10-year solution or a 20-plus year system guides our material recommendations and installation approach.

Downtime constraints often drive coating selection, especially for commercial operations. Our rapid-cure polyaspartic systems can transform a space in just one day, getting you back to business quickly. This is particularly valuable for businesses that can’t afford extended shutdowns.

When we evaluate coating performance, we focus on three key metrics that tell the real story of durability. Shore D Hardness measures resistance to indentation and scratching – our Extra Heavy Duty AG Acid Shield boasts an impressive 88-90 Shore D rating. To put this in perspective, a construction hard hat typically measures around 75-80, so anything above 75 is excellent performance.

The Abrasion Loss Rating using the Taber C-17 test quantifies how well a coating resists wear over time. Lower milligram loss means better durability – our Extra Heavy Duty AG Acid Shield system shows just 20mg abrasion loss, indicating exceptional longevity under heavy use.

Compressive Strength reveals how well the coating handles heavy loads and impacts. At 9,900 PSI, our premium systems are incredibly strong and resistant to the kind of punishment that destroys unprotected concrete.

The Importance of Professional Installation and Maintenance

Even the highest quality chemical resistant floor coating won’t deliver its promised performance without proper installation and ongoing care. This is where our expertise and attention to detail make all the difference.

Professional installation begins long before we open the first coating container. The foundation of any successful coating system is meticulous surface preparation. We use diamond grinding techniques to remove all contaminants and create the ideal surface profile for maximum adhesion. Any cracks or imperfections get expertly repaired before we apply the primer system.

Our precise application techniques ensure a seamless bond between the coating and your concrete substrate. We control temperature, humidity, and application thickness to prevent issues like delamination or premature failure.

Maintenance best practices are surprisingly simple but absolutely critical for long-term performance. The golden rule is prompt spill cleanup – even with excellent chemical resistance, prolonged exposure to harsh substances can eventually affect coating integrity. Think of it like sunscreen – it provides great protection, but you wouldn’t leave it untested indefinitely.

Using pH-neutral cleaners specifically approved for your coating system protects the surface from unnecessary wear. Harsh chemicals or abrasive scrubbing pads can damage the protective topcoat, so we always recommend gentle cleaning approaches that maintain the floor’s appearance and performance.

Regular inspections help catch minor issues before they become major problems. A quick visual check every few months can identify areas that might need attention, potentially saving significant repair costs down the road.

The reality is that proper maintenance extends your floor’s lifespan dramatically while preserving its appearance and protective qualities. When you invest in a quality chemical resistant floor coating with professional installation, you’re setting yourself up for years of reliable performance with minimal ongoing effort.

Are all epoxy floors equally chemical resistant?

This is one of the most important questions we get, and the answer is a definitive no. Calling something an “epoxy floor” is like saying you drive a “car” – it doesn’t tell you much about what’s under the hood.

Standard epoxy coatings offer decent protection against everyday spills and mild chemicals. They’re fine for light-duty applications, but they have their limits.

Novolac epoxy systems are in a completely different league. These specialized formulations are engineered specifically for hostile chemical environments. When you’re dealing with concentrated acids, caustic chemicals, or prolonged chemical immersion, this is what you need. The difference in performance between standard epoxy and Novolac can be dramatic.

The quality of the epoxy itself is also a major factor. We use 100% solids epoxy, meaning the product is made of pure resin and hardener for maximum protection. This professional-grade formulation creates a thicker, more durable, and more chemically resistant barrier than formulations with high water or solvent content, which is essential for withstanding aggressive environments.

The resin type matters enormously. Without knowing the specific formulation and chemistry, you can’t assume any epoxy will protect against serious chemical exposure. That’s why we take the time to understand exactly what chemicals you’re dealing with before recommending a system.

How do you clean and maintain these floors?

Here’s some great news: maintaining your chemical resistant floor coating is surprisingly simple. The seamless, non-porous surface we create makes cleaning almost effortless compared to bare concrete.

For everyday cleaning, you really can’t get much simpler. A quick sweep or vacuum to remove debris, followed by mopping with warm water, handles most situations. The smooth surface doesn’t trap dirt and grime like porous concrete does.

When you need something stronger, stick with pH-neutral, non-abrasive cleaners. These gentle solutions will keep your floor spotless without compromising the coating’s integrity. We can recommend specific products that work perfectly with your system.

Prompt spill cleanup is your best friend. While our floors are designed to resist chemicals, cleaning up spills quickly prevents any prolonged exposure and keeps your coating performing at its best for years to come.

What should you avoid? Harsh chemicals and abrasive tools are the enemies of long-lasting floors. Skip the steel wool, abrasive pads, and highly concentrated cleaners unless we’ve specifically approved them for your particular coating system.

The bottom line? A little common sense goes a long way. Treat your floor well, and it’ll keep looking great and protecting your concrete for decades.
